Introduction: In today's fast-paced world, maintaining high energy levels throughout the day is essential for achieving productivity and enjoying a fulfilling lifestyle. While there are countless energy drinks and supplements on the market, a healthier and more sustainable way to boost your energy levels is by incorporating the right foods into your diet. In this blog post, we will explore DIY home energy-boosting foods that are not only easy to prepare but also effective in providing sustainable energy for your body and mind. 1. Oatmeal Power Bowl: Starting your day with a power-packed breakfast is crucial for maintaining energy levels. A bowl of oatmeal is an excellent choice as it is a complex carbohydrate that is slowly released into the bloodstream, providing a steady supply of energy. To make your oatmeal bowl even more energizing, add toppings like fresh fruits, nuts, seeds, and a drizzle of honey or maple syrup to enhance the flavor and nutritional value. 2. Green Smoothies: Green smoothies are a fantastic way to incorporate nutrient-dense ingredients into your daily routine. Packed with essential v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ants, these vibrant concoctions provide a natural energy boost without the crash associated with caffeine or sugar. Blend together a handful of leafy greens like spinach or kale with a variety of fruits, such as bananas, berries, and citrus, to create a refreshing and energizing smoothie. 3. Energizing Snacks: When your energy levels start to dip in the afternoon, having healthy snacks on hand can keep you going until dinner time. Opt for snacks that are rich in fiber, protein, and healthy fats, such as mixed nuts, Greek yogurt with fresh fruit, homemade energy balls, or whole-grain crackers with hummus. These snacks will not only provide sustained energy but also help stabilize blood sugar levels, preventing energy crashes. 4. Power Packed Salads: Salads don't have to be boring. By incorporating a variety of nutrient-dense ingredients, you can transform a simple bowl of greens into a powerful energy-boosting meal. Add protein-rich ingredients such as grilled chicken, boiled eggs, or tofu, along with leafy greens, colorful vegetables, whole grains like quinoa or bulgur, and a flavorful dressing. This combination provides a balance of macronutrients while delivering essential vitamins and minerals. 5. Homemade Energy Bars: Store-bought energy bars can be convenient, but they often contain additives and excessive amounts of sugar. DIY energy bars, on the other hand, allow you to control the ingredients and customize the flavors according to your preferences. Combine oats, nuts, seeds, dried fruits, and a natural sweetener like honey or dates, then bake or refrigerate until firm. These homemade bars are a perfect on-the-go snack that will provide a quick boost of energy without the artificial additives. Conclusion: Feeding your body with the right nutrients is the key to maintaining steady energy levels throughout the day. By incorporating these DIY home energy-boosting foods into your daily routine, you'll experience sustained energy, increased focus, and improved productivity. Remember, consistency is key, so make it a habit to include these foods in your diet and feel the difference in your energy levels and overall well-being.
